Transaction Analysis and Adjustments Dole Carpet Cleaners ended its first month of operations on June 30. Monthly financial statements will be prepared. The unadjusted account balances are as follows: The following information is also available: 1. The balance in Prepaid Rent was the amount paid on June 1 for the first 4 months' rent. 2. Supplies on hand at June 30 were $820. 3. The equipment, purchased June 1, has an estimated life of 5 years. The depreciation for the period has already been recorded for you in the TAT. 4. Unpaid wages at June 30 were $210. 5. Utility services used during June were estimated at $300. A bill is expected early in July. 6. Fees earned for services performed but not yet billed on June 30 were $380. The firm uses the account Fees Receivable to reflect amounts due but not yet billed. a. Determine the financial statement effect of the adjustments needed at June 30 using the Transaction Analysis Template. b. Prepare the income statement for the month of June and balance sheet as of June 30
